Skip to content
New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

Fix #1325, Prepend system log messages with function name #1611

Merged
merged 2 commits into from
Jun 15, 2021

Conversation

skliper
Copy link
Contributor

@skliper skliper commented Jun 8, 2021

Describe the contribution
Fix #1325 - Standardizes system log messages with a prefixed function name

Testing performed
Built and passed unit tests.

Expected behavior changes
Only modified output string of syslog.

System(s) tested on

  • Hardware: Intel I5/Docker
  • OS: Ubuntu 18.04
  • Versions: cFS Bundle + this commit

Additional context
Note this will have a conflict with #1566, easy to resolve. I fix once it's in.

Third party code
None

Contributor Info - All information REQUIRED for consideration of pull request
Jacob Hageman - NASA/GSFC

@skliper skliper added the CCB:Ready Ready for discussion at the Configuration Control Board (CCB) label Jun 8, 2021
@skliper skliper added this to the 7.0.0 milestone Jun 8, 2021
@skliper skliper force-pushed the fix1325-syslog_func branch from fa3d5f8 to 43d6789 Compare June 8, 2021 21:15
@astrogeco astrogeco added CCB:Approved Indicates code review and approval by community CCB and removed CCB:Ready Ready for discussion at the Configuration Control Board (CCB) labels Jun 9, 2021
@astrogeco
Copy link
Contributor

CCB:2021-06-09 APPROVED

@astrogeco astrogeco changed the base branch from main to integration-candidate June 15, 2021 02:34
@skliper skliper force-pushed the fix1325-syslog_func branch from 43d6789 to 6167442 Compare June 15, 2021 15:42
@skliper
Copy link
Contributor Author

skliper commented Jun 15, 2021

@astrogeco - rebased, conflicts resolved.

@skliper skliper removed the conflicts label Jun 15, 2021
@skliper skliper force-pushed the fix1325-syslog_func branch from 6167442 to bdd27bd Compare June 15, 2021 15:49
@skliper skliper force-pushed the fix1325-syslog_func branch from bdd27bd to abe68b5 Compare June 15, 2021 15:52
@astrogeco astrogeco merged commit 8752126 into nasa:integration-candidate Jun 15, 2021
astrogeco added a commit to nasa/cFS that referenced this pull request Jun 16, 2021
nasa/cFE#1600, Add workflow to build cFE documentation

nasa/cFE#1609, Requirements updates

nasa/cFE#1610, ES/ResourceID documentation cleanup

nasa/cFE#1613, allow multiple sources in add_cfe_coverage_test

nasa/cFE#1586, add ES Misc Functional test

nasa/cFE#1607, add Mempool functional tests

nasa/cFE#1605, Clean/simplify version header and reporting

nasa/cFE#1612, 1589, doxygen cleanup

nasa/cFE#1611, Prepend system log messages with function name
astrogeco added a commit to nasa/cFS that referenced this pull request Jun 17, 2021
nasa/cFE#1619 - cfe v6.8.0-rc1+dev693
nasa/osal#1076 - osal v5.1.0-rc1+dev530
nasa/PSP#296 - psp v1.5.0-rc1+dev118

*Documentation Updates:*

nasa/cFE#1598, Updated FS Read/WriteHeader API return documentation
nasa/cFE#1601, Document CFE_ES_RunLoop increment task counter behavior
nasa/cFE#1602, Document CFE_TBL_Unregister use-case
nasa/cFE#1603, Update version description per current design

*Standardize docs generation:*

nasa/cFE#1615, standardize on "docs" subdirectory
nasa/osal#1071, rename doc to docs
nasa/PSP#294, rename doc to docs

*Coding Standard:*

nasa/osal#1042
nasa/PSP#292

**Mutex for UTAssert**

nasa/cFE#1596, provide CFE assert lock/unlock
nasa/osal#1065, add mutex lock around UtAssert globals

*Resolve API-UT discrepancies:*

nasa/osal#1055, idmap API
nasa/osal#1056, file API
nasa/osal#1057, filesys API
nasa/osal#1060, socket API
nasa/osal#1064, select API

**Other cFE ixes**

nasa/cFE#1566, Simplify CFE_FS_SetTimestamp and fix syslog typo
nasa/cFE#1592, Removed redundant check/set of CFE_CPU_ID_VALUE
nasa/cFE#1593, add time get reference error bit
nasa/cFE#1600, Add workflow to build cFE documentation
nasa/cFE#1609, Requirements updates
nasa/cFE#1610, ES/ResourceID documentation cleanup
nasa/cFE#1613, allow multiple sources in add_cfe_coverage_test
nasa/cFE#1586, add ES Misc Functional test
nasa/cFE#1607, add Mempool functional tests
nasa/cFE#1605, Clean/simplify version header and reporting
nasa/cFE#1612, doxygen cleanup
nasa/cFE#1611, Prepend system log messages with function name

nasa/osal#1063, const correct OS_SelectFdIsSet
nasa/osal#1073, Fix OS_Select doxygen errors
nasa/osal#1073, Add missing OS_Select param doc
nasa/osal#1067, Add Workflow to build and verify OSAL API Guide
nasa/osal#1070, add detail design template
nasa/osal#1072, Update error codes and documentation
nasa/osal#1075, Increase UT object limit for testing

Co-authored-by: Jacob Hageman <skliper@users.noreply.github.com>
Co-authored-by: Joseph Hickey <jphickey@users.noreply.github.com>
Co-authored-by: Ariel Adams <ArielSAdamsNASA@users.noreply.github.com>
Co-authored-by: Alex Campbell <zanzaben@users.noreply.github.com>
Co-authored-by: Jose F Martinez Pedraza <pepepr08@users.noreply.github.com>
astrogeco added a commit to nasa/cFS that referenced this pull request Jun 17, 2021
nasa/cFE#1619 - cfe v6.8.0-rc1+dev693
nasa/osal#1076 - osal v5.1.0-rc1+dev530
nasa/PSP#296 - psp v1.5.0-rc1+dev118

*Documentation Updates:*

nasa/cFE#1598, Updated FS Read/WriteHeader API return documentation
nasa/cFE#1601, Document CFE_ES_RunLoop increment task counter behavior
nasa/cFE#1602, Document CFE_TBL_Unregister use-case
nasa/cFE#1603, Update version description per current design

*Standardize docs generation:*

nasa/cFE#1615, standardize on "docs" subdirectory
nasa/osal#1071, rename doc to docs
nasa/PSP#294, rename doc to docs

*Coding Standard:*

nasa/osal#1042
nasa/PSP#292

**Mutex for UTAssert**

nasa/cFE#1596, provide CFE assert lock/unlock
nasa/osal#1065, add mutex lock around UtAssert globals

*Resolve API-UT discrepancies:*

nasa/osal#1055, idmap API
nasa/osal#1056, file API
nasa/osal#1057, filesys API
nasa/osal#1060, socket API
nasa/osal#1064, select API

**Other cFE Fixes**

nasa/cFE#1566, Simplify CFE_FS_SetTimestamp and fix syslog typo
nasa/cFE#1592, Removed redundant check/set of CFE_CPU_ID_VALUE
nasa/cFE#1593, add time get reference error bit
nasa/cFE#1600, Add workflow to build cFE documentation
nasa/cFE#1609, Requirements updates
nasa/cFE#1610, ES/ResourceID documentation cleanup
nasa/cFE#1613, allow multiple sources in add_cfe_coverage_test
nasa/cFE#1586, add ES Misc Functional test
nasa/cFE#1607, add Mempool functional tests
nasa/cFE#1605, Clean/simplify version header and reporting
nasa/cFE#1612, doxygen cleanup
nasa/cFE#1611, Prepend system log messages with function name

**Other osal Fixes**

nasa/osal#1063, const correct OS_SelectFdIsSet
nasa/osal#1073, Fix OS_Select doxygen errors
nasa/osal#1073, Add missing OS_Select param doc
nasa/osal#1067, Add Workflow to build and verify OSAL API Guide
nasa/osal#1070, add detail design template
nasa/osal#1072, Update error codes and documentation
nasa/osal#1075, Increase UT object limit for testing

Co-authored-by: Jacob Hageman <skliper@users.noreply.github.com>
Co-authored-by: Joseph Hickey <jphickey@users.noreply.github.com>
Co-authored-by: Ariel Adams <ArielSAdamsNASA@users.noreply.github.com>
Co-authored-by: Alex Campbell <zanzaben@users.noreply.github.com>
Co-authored-by: Jose F Martinez Pedraza <pepepr08@users.noreply.github.com>
@skliper skliper deleted the fix1325-syslog_func branch October 22, 2021 19:25
#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
CCB:Approved Indicates code review and approval by community CCB
Projects
None yet
Development

Successfully merging this pull request may close these issues.

Use %s, _func_ for all syslog messages
2 participants